Spiced meringue cookies with crushed gingersnaps folded into whipped egg whites with cinnamon and ginger. Crisp, airy, and virtually fat-free with a snappy ginger crunch.
Soft gingerbread cookies with molasses, hot coffee, cinnamon, cloves, and ground ginger. A rollout cookie dough for gingerbread men with a tender, cake-like texture instead of a crisp snap.
Mock apple pie made with crackers instead of apples, boiled in sugar syrup with cream of tartar. A Depression-era trick pie that tastes surprisingly like real apple pie without a single apple.
Tropical quesadillas filled with ripe banana, green chilies, and Monterey Jack cheese with a squeeze of lime. A sweet-savory snack or dessert ready in 15 minutes.
Baked rice souffle with a creamy milk-cooked rice base, whipped egg whites for lift, and a homemade raspberry sauce. A light, elegant French-style dessert with a golden top.
No-bake key lime pie made with lime gelatin, sweetened condensed milk, fresh lime juice, and zest folded into a beaten egg-white cloud. A retro Florida pie that sets up cold without an oven.
Thin, lacy sesame wafers with nutty toasted sesame seeds and brown sugar. These crisp, buttery cookies spread into golden wafers as they bake, making 4 dozen irresistible treats.
Mix-in-pan carrot cake: stir all ingredients directly in the baking pan with a fork, no extra bowls or mixers. Spiced with cinnamon and allspice, topped with classic cream cheese frosting.
Buttermilk pie whisks tangy buttermilk with sugar, eggs, melted margarine, flour, and lemon extract into a sweet-tangy single-crust pie. Classic Southern five-minute pie filling.
Monkey tails are frozen chocolate-dipped bananas on a stick, brushed with orange juice to prevent browning. A fun, easy no-bake treat kids can help make.
Soft orange poppy seed cookies made with cream cheese, fresh orange zest, and orange juice. Light, cakey, and bright with citrus in every bite.
Orange shortbread bars with fresh orange zest and cornstarch for a melt-in-your-mouth sandy texture. Score before baking for clean, even cuts.
Four-ingredient cookie crust with butter, flour, and sugar pressed into a sheet pan. Golden, buttery base for bars, cheesecakes, and dessert squares.
A silky baked custard made with just 4 ingredients: mint chocolate chips, milk, sweetened condensed milk, and eggs. Cooked in a gentle water bath for a spoonable, minty chocolate treat.
Lemon roll-out cookies with sour cream in the dough for a tender crumb, brushed with lemon juice and sprinkled with sugar before baking. The bright citrusy cookie cutter staple for any holiday tray.
Four-ingredient homemade crumb crust with flour, butter, cinnamon, and a pinch of salt. Mixes in 5 minutes for a buttery, lightly spiced pie base or streusel topping.
